Chapter 12
SVG and MathML
An interesting and important aspect of HTML5 is the fact that SVG (Scalable Vector Graphics) and MathML (Mathematical Markup Language), both XML applications, have been imported into HTML5. SVG supports drawing, transforming and animating two-dimensional (2D) vector graphics. MathML provides encodings for the display (Presentation MathML) and semantics (Content MathML) of mathematical expressions.
In addition to displaying the occasional vector graphics and mathematical expressions, SVG and MathML add significant scientific dimensions to HTML5 in dealing with 2D geometry and manipulating mathematical formulas. Their impact on technical communication and education will surely grow with time.
In this chapter, we begin ...
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Read now
Unlock full access